    Abstract: A chair includes a seat section, a back section and a spine support member. The back section includes a frame having an upper side, a lower side and lateral sides which form an opening, the lower side being in closer proximity to the seat section than the upper side. The back section further includes a material portion attached to the frame which extends across the opening. The back section has a front side and a back side with the front side in closer proximity to the seat section than the back side. The spine support member is attached to the back side of the back section and positioned against a rear of the material portion, the spine support member having an elongated shape with a major axis intersecting the upper and lower sides of the frame.

    Abstract: The seat depth adjustable motor vehicle seat comprises a first seat part, a second seat part and a longitudinal adjustment device interposed between the first seat part and the second seat part and allowing for displacement movement in a first seat direction of the first seat part relative to the second seat part. The seat further comprises a toothed rack connected to the second seat part and extending substantially in the first seat direction. A primary gear meshes with the toothed rack. A secondary gear is in rotating communication with the primary gear. A toothed bar extends substantially in a second seat direction and engages the secondary gear. A third seat part is slidably disposed in the second seat direction and is connected to the toothed bar.

    Abstract: A pneumatic lordosis support (1) consists of a cushion (3), which is integrated into the backrest (2) of a seat. Laterally of a vertical center line (7), the cushion encompasses horizontal connections (8) between a front side and a rear side of the cushion (3). The cushion (3) is composed of an air-tight flexible membrane. In the region of the vertical center line (7), the connections (8) encompass breaks. Vertically offset to the connections (8), the cushion (3) encompasses further central horizontal connections (10), which extend substantially across the region of the breaks in the connection (8). In the region where connections (8) and central connections (10) are located close to one another, reduced radii of the membrane lead to the occurrence of less stress than in the remaining cushions (3) and allow the spine of a user to dip into the cushion (3) more softly.

    Abstract: An armrest for use with a motorized vehicle is provided comprising first and second substantially opposing surfaces elongated longitudinally along the vehicle's interior surface and extending laterally inward therefrom. The armrest also includes a substantially vertical wall portion extending from the inner periphery of the first and second surfaces. The first and second surfaces define a plurality of channels oriented substantially parallel to one another and elongated longitudinally relative to the vehicle, in either a parallel or oblique fashion relative to a longitudinal axis of the vehicle. The plurality of channels is configured to sustain substantial vertical loading and controllably deform under a predetermined threshold lateral crush load. In addition, the plurality of channels preferably includes one or more partitions within each of the channels that are oriented relative to one another to thereby create a load path for lateral loads imparted to the armrest assembly.

    Abstract: A chair is provided that is designed so that the angle of the seat surface portion and the angle of the back surface portion are independent of each other and change, and a user can always take the optimum seated posture. The chair includes a base portion, a first link fixed to a seat and rotatably connected to the base portion, and a second link fixed to a seat back rest and rotatably connected to the first link. The chair also includes a first torque-generating mechanism that generates torque in accordance with the angle of the first link relative to the base portion; and a second torque-generating mechanism that generates torque in accordance with the angle of the second link relative to the first link.
